Summary
This study tests whether large language models (LLMs) — the same kind of AI behind chatbots — can predict what will happen to patients in the emergency department, such as whether they will be admitted to the hospital or need imaging. Researchers will analyze about 100,000 real emergency cases from a German hospital, comparing the AI's predictions to actual outcomes. They will also check whether removing personal information from the data harms the AI's accuracy.

Who is studied
All consecutive treatment cases at the Central Emergency Department of University Hospital Cologne during 01 January 2023 - 31 December 2025 (full census, approximately 100,000 cases).

Inclusion Criteria: * All consecutive treatment cases at the Central Emergency Department of University Hospital Cologne during the period 01 January 2023 - 31 December 2025 (full census, consecutive inclusion). Exclusion Criteria: * Documented objection to the scientific use of the data pursuant to Art. 21 General data protection Regulation (GDPR). * Cases lacking the minimum data required for analysis (triage/history and documented outcome).
